The trust was set up in 2003 in memory of eloise and katie plunkett - two young sisters who both died of cancer. It (a) funds small projects in england and scotland that make a real difference to the lives of young people and (b) supports causes which are important to the plunkett family - particularly cancer and parkinson's disease.
